You have given us virtual channel numbers. What we need are callsigns and real channel numbers. The problem is that the subchannels you want come and go from the main network channels. They are often hard to track down, but we will try.

An added problem is that TVFool is using a defective database, so the reports often have errors, but we can make comparisons with reports from other sites.
